Overview

Wallace Alston is an Infectious Disease provider in Burlington, Vermont. Dr. Alston is highly rated in 5 conditions, according to our data. His top areas of expertise are Myelitis, HIV/AIDS, AIDS Dementia Complex, AIDS Dysmorphic Syndrome, and Splenectomy.

His clinical research consists of co-authoring 10 peer reviewed articles. MediFind looks at clinical research from the past 15 years.
